Whakarāpopototanga:"Novel Colloidal Forming of Ceramics" discusses several new near-net-shape techniques for fabricating highly reliable, high-performance ceramic parts. These techniques combine injection molding and the colloidal forming process. The book not only introduces the basic theoretical development and applications of the colloidal injection molding of ceramics, but also covers tape casting technology, the reliability of the product, and the colloidal injection molding of Si3N4 and SiC, as well as the low-toxicity system. The book is intended for researchers and graduates in materials science and engineering. Mr. Yong Huang and Dr. Jinlong Yang are both professors at the Department of Materials Science and Engineering, Tsinghua University, China
